This part of ISO10791 specifies, with reference to ISO230-1, the geometric tests for machining centres (or other numerically controlled machines, where applicable) with horizontal spindle (i.e. horizontal Z-axis).

This part of ISO10791 applies to machining centres having three numerically controlled linear axes (X-axis up to 5000mm length, Y-axis up to 3200mm length, and Z-axis up to 2000mm length), but refers also to supplementary movements, such as those of rotary, tilting, and swivelling tables. Movements other than those mentioned are considered as special features and the relevant tests are not included in this part of ISO10791.

This part of ISO10791 takes into consideration in AnnexesA through D four possible types of tables, fixed and rotary, as hereunder described:

  • AnnexA: horizontal non-rotating tables;

  • AnnexB: tables rotating around a vertical B’-axis;

  • AnnexC: tables rotating around a vertical B’-axis and tilting around a horizontal A’-axis;

  • AnnexD: tables rotating around a horizontal A’-axis and swivelling around a vertical B’-axis.

This part of ISO10791 does not consider accessory spindle heads, which are covered by ISO17543-1:—1.

This part of ISO10791 deals only with the verification of geometric accuracy of the machine and does not apply to the testing of the machine operation, which should generally be checked separately. Tests not concerning the pure geometric accuracy of the machine are dealt with in other parts of ISO10791, as listed in the Foreword.
